Regarding optimizing the greatest polished stone yield from rough pieces , strategic selection of initial size is vital, particularly within the 1-2 carat spectrum . Often, roughs measuring between 0.80ct to 1.20ct present the best opportunities for maximizing carat weight retention, minimizing wastage, and ultimately delivering a more substantial polished diamond . However , specific rough characteristics like shape, clarity, and color affect the expected outcome; therefore, skilled buyers must evaluate these factors alongside size when deciding on purchases.

Raw to Gleaming: Exploring Stone's Scale & Polished Output

The journey from a unprocessed diamond to a radiant gemstone is fascinating, and significantly impacted by two key factors: its initial size and the resulting cut yield. A larger diamond, initially, doesn’t automatically equate to a larger finished piece; much of it can be lost during the cutting process. The “yield" refers to the weight – or percentage – retained after cutting. Factors like inclusions, hue and purity all affect how a lapidarist approaches a stone and thus influence the final finished weight. A skilled artisan strives to maximize the yield while preserving beauty – finding that delicate balance between loss and brilliance is what separates an ordinary gemstone from an exceptional one.

Gem Investing: Prioritizing High-Quality & Large Carat Stones

For those considering gem investing as a approach, it's crucial to understand that not all stones are created equal. Generally, the most reliable returns and potential for value increase lie with exceptional diamonds, specifically those exhibiting larger carat. These gems, possessing a combination of excellent clarity, color, and cut—often falling within the VS or better clarity range and D to G color grades – tend to hold their value more effectively over time.

  • Examine stones with documented provenance.
  • Look for certifications from reputable laboratories.
  • A larger weight, especially above 3 carats, often commands a higher price per carat, but also potentially offers greater future returns if purchased strategically.
Investing in these types of diamonds requires careful investigation and may necessitate engaging with experienced gemologists or brokers, but the potential rewards for a discerning investor can be substantial.
